Description
Changes proposed in this Pull Request
Implementation of the DIFM upsell offer A/B test. For more context, check pcbrnV-12W-p2.
A quick summary of changes:
- A/B test the DIFM upsell offer copy for users who purchase a Business or eCommerce plan. Check this Figma for the design.
- Business plan users who decline the upsell will be taken to Customer Home. Those who Accept the offer, they will be taken to an intake form page which displays embedded the Crowdsignal DIFM survey. Successful completion of the survey will take the user to Customer Home.
- eCommerce users who decline the upsell will be taken to the Atomic Thank You page. Those who Accept the offer will be taken to an intake form page which displays embedded the Crowdsignal DIFM survey. Successful completion of the survey will take the user to Customer Home.
DIFM Upsell offer
DIFM intake form
Testing instructions
Apply patch D56268-code
Scenario 1
- Assign yourself to the treatment of the
post_purchase_difm_upsell
experiment.
- Go through the signup flow and purchase a Business plan. Verify that you see the DIFM upsell offer.
- Declining the offer should take to thank you page.
- Accepting the offer should take to a DIFM intake survey. Successful completion of the survey should take to Customer Home with a notice indicating successful form submission. Note that the form redirects to wordpress.com on successful submission, so replace the domain with calypso url to see the success notice.
- You should receive an email with a link to the DIFM intake page on accepting the upsell offer.
- Go through the signup flow and purchase an eCommerce plan. Verify that you see the DIFM upsell offer.
- Declining the offer should take to the atomic Thank You page
- Accepting the offer should take to a DIFM intake survey. Successful completion of the survey should take to atomic Thank You page.
- You should receive an email with a link to the DIFM intake page on accepting the upsell offer.
Scenario 2
- Assign yourself to
control
of the post_purchase_difm_upsell
experiment.
- Verify that control experience is unchanged for Business purchase, After purchasing a Business plan, you’re either taken to Customer Home or shown a Quick Start upsell, depending on which variant you get assigned on the Quick Start offer test.
- Verify that control experience is unchanged for eCommerce purchase. After purchasing an eCommerce plan, you should be taken to the atomic Thank You page.
Unfortunately, no screenshots were provided by the developer.